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or attribute group

In document User's Guide - Beta 1 Draft (Page 69-76)

The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or attribute group provides information about the root virtual processor of the hypervisor.

Historical group

This attribute group is eligible for use with Tivoli Data Warehouse.

Attribute descriptions

The following list contains information about each attribute in the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or attribute group:

Warehouse name TIMESTAMP Percent Guest Run Time attribute

Description

The percentage of time that the root virtual processor takes to run the non-hypervisor code on a logical processor.

Type

Real number (32-bit gauge) with two decimal places of precision with

enumerated values. The strings are displayed in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al. The warehouse and queries return the values that are shown in parentheses. The following values are defined:

v Value Exceeds Maximum (2147483647) v Value Exceeds Minimum (-2147483648)

Any other value is the value that is returned by the agent in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al.

Source

The source for this attribute is Perfmon -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or\*\% Guest Run Time.

Warehouse name

PCT_GUEST_RUN_TIME or GUEST_RUN_

Percent Hypervisor Run Time attribute

Description

The percentage of time that the root virtual processor takes to run the hypervisor code on a logical processor.

Type

Real number (32-bit gauge) with two decimal places of precision with

enumerated values. The strings are displayed in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al. The warehouse and queries return the values that are shown in parentheses. The following values are defined:

v Value Exceeds Maximum (2147483647) v Value Exceeds Minimum (-2147483648)

Any other value is the value that is returned by the agent in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al.

Source

The source for this attribute is Perfmon -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or\*\% Hypervisor Run Time.

Warehouse name

PCT_HYPERVISOR_RUN_TIME or HYPERVISOR Percent Total Run Time attribute

Description

The percentage of the total runtime on each virtual processor, where total runtime is the sum of the Percentage Guest Runtime and the Percentage Hypervisor Runtime attributes.

Type

Real number (32-bit gauge) with two decimal places of precision with

enumerated values. The strings are displayed in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al. The warehouse and queries return the values that are shown in parentheses. The following values are defined:

v Value Exceeds Maximum (2147483647) v Value Exceeds Minimum (-2147483648)

Any other value is the value that is returned by the agent in the Tivoli Enterprise Portal.

Source

The source for this attribute is Perfmon - Hyper-V Hypervisor Root Virtual Processor\*\% Total Run Time.

Warehouse name

PCT_TOTAL_RUN_TIME or TOTAL_RUN_
